What is the Teacher Apprenticeship Program?

The Teacher Apprenticeship Program (TAP) is a growing initiative across the U.S. aimed at addressing teacher shortages by offering alternative, hands-on pathways into the teaching profession. The TAP program offers the apprentice the opportunity to learn and earn while working and acquiring new skills in the real-world classroom setting.

The apprentice will work in a paraprofessional role in Alief ISD. Apprentices engage in active learning all while completing college or certification coursework. The program length can be anywhere from one to four years. Apprentices will attain a bachelor’s degree and teacher certification by the end of the program with little to no cost to the apprentice.

TAP Spotlight

Each month we are shining a spotlight on an apprentice in our TAP newsletters, celebrating their achievements, sharing their journey, and highlighting the impact they’re making in their roles.

TAP

During Ms. Alvarado’s freshman year of high school, she was placed in the education and training program, though she was initially unsure if teaching was the right career path. Her perspective changed in her junior year when she had the opportunity to work in a kindergarten classroom, where she discovered a deep passion for teaching young children. A major influence in her journey was her teacher, Mrs. Lotsu, who encouraged her to strive for excellence and helped shape her into the aspiring teacher she is today.

When asked, what grade level Ms. Alvarado would like to teach, she shared that she’s excited about teaching 1st grade, as she enjoys working with young learners and is eager to help nurture their development. Her goal this year is to make a difference in her students’ lives, and to be successful in her college coursework as a first-year college student.

Ms. Alvarado finds motivation in reflecting on how far she has come at such a young age and feels deeply grateful for the opportunity to be part of the Teacher Apprenticeship Program (TAP). She shared that this experience has been a true blessing for both her and her family—allowing her to work in a job she loves while attending college without facing financial barriers. Her determination to make her parents proud and to build a future she can be proud of is what drives her every single day.

TAP Training Schedule

As an apprentice, you’ll participate in monthly training sessions(7 per on-ramp). Each session will focus on learning competency-based microcredentials that are designed to strengthen your teaching toolkit and equip you with effective instructional strategies. These trainings will help prepare you for your residency and your future role as a certified teacher. These training will be at the CTD building. Please see the schedule below.

TAP Check-In Schedule

We will conduct 4 check-in appointments with our apprentices. These check-ins are a valuable opportunity to connect with our apprentices, learn more about their experiences in their roles, and ensure their college coursework is progressing smoothly.

TAP Launch 2025-2026 School Year

We are thrilled to welcome our inaugural cohort as we officially launch the Teacher Apprenticeship Program (TAP). Our apprentices arrived with enthusiasm and a strong sense of purpose, ready to embrace this transformative journey toward becoming educators.

Through the program, participants engage in classroom experiences, collaborate with experienced teachers, and receive guidance on lesson planning, classroom management, and instructional strategies. These experiences equip them with the skills, confidence, and insight needed to thrive as future educators.

We look forward to supporting each apprentice as they grow into inspiring educators.
